Two teens arrested and accused of throwing a rock from the side of a Kentucky road, seriously injuring driver, authorities say.

"If it was just a few inches higher, it could have been a whole lot worse."

The two boys, ages 14 and 15, are accused of two rock throwing incidents that night, including the one that hurt Wehner, authorities said. The 14-year-old was charged with first-degree assault and second-degree criminal mischief and the 15-year-old was charged with first-degree complicity to assault and second-degree criminal mischief, authorities said.
